Batch editing:
You can now select multiple terms in the term list via a selection mode and perform an action for multiple terms at the same time via an editing menu, such as adding a subject area or other attribute or changing the usage status of terms.
Changing the entry ID when merging duplicates
We have made a small addition to the duplicate cleanup: When merging duplicates, you can now select the entry ID that you want to keep for the duplicate entries and use for the main entry.
This can be helpful when merging two databases, such as when an ID of a deleted duplicate entry is to remain accessible for subsequent exports to third-party systems.
New export formats for TermStar and Smartling
With this update, we are adding a new TBX format specifically for TermStar from the STAR Group to our long list of export formats.
We have also updated the TBX format for Smartling so that it now uses TBX version 3.
